Exactly what is an Automatic Hoover?

An automatic hoover, or robot robotic vacuum cleaners vacuum, is a self-propelled, autonomous cleaning device designed to navigate your home and vacuum floors without human intervention. These compact, typically disc-shaped makers make use of a combination of sensing units, mapping innovation, and brushes to efficiently get rid of dust, debris, and pet hair from numerous floor types. They run on rechargeable batteries and typically return to a docking station to charge when their battery is low or cleaning cycle is complete.

The magic behind these little cleaners lies in their advanced technology. Early models relied on easy bump-and-go navigation, bouncing arbitrarily around the room until a location was deemed sufficiently cleaned. However, modern-day robot vacuums are considerably more innovative. They utilize sophisticated navigation systems, such as:
Random Bounce Navigation: While still present in some spending plan alternatives, this system involves the robot relocating random instructions, changing course when it encounters a challenge. It's less efficient but typically more budget-friendly.Methodical Navigation: This approach includes the robot cleaning in arranged patterns, generally rows or zig-zags, ensuring more detailed coverage. This is frequently achieved through gyroscopic sensing units or standard mapping.LiDAR (Light Detection and Ranging) Mapping: LiDAR innovation uses lasers to produce an in-depth map of your home. This permits extremely effective cleaning, obstacle avoidance, and the capability to customize cleaning zones and no-go locations.Camera-Based Mapping: Some robot vacuums utilize electronic cameras to visualize their environments and develop maps. This can be combined with visual SLAM (Simultaneous Localization and Mapping) technology for exact navigation and things recognition.
These navigation systems, combined with powerful suction motors, turning brushes, and often mopping functionalities, make automatic hoovers invaluable tools for maintaining clean floors with very little effort.

Key Features to Scrutinize When Choosing Your Automatic Hoover

Choosing the right automatic hoover is vital to ensure it efficiently fulfills your cleaning needs and fits your lifestyle. Consider these vital features before buying:

Navigation System: As mentioned earlier, the navigation system is the brain of your robot vacuum. Consider your home design and desired level of cleaning performance. For intricate layouts with numerous spaces and barriers, LiDAR or camera-based mapping provides exceptional efficiency. For smaller sized, easier spaces, organized and even random bounce navigation may be adequate for a more budget-friendly alternative.

Suction Power: Suction power is a critical factor in figuring out cleaning effectiveness. Greater suction power is generally much better for carpets and homes with family pets, effectively raising ingrained dirt and pet hair. Search for designs with adjustable suction levels to adjust to various floor types.

Battery Life and Coverage Area: Battery life dictates the amount of time your robot vacuum can clean on a single charge. Consider the size of your home. Larger homes need longer battery life or models with recharge-and-resume abilities, where the robot returns to the dock to recharge and after that continues cleaning where it ended.

Dustbin Capacity: The size of the dustbin determines how regularly you require to empty it. Larger dustbins are preferable for homes with family pets or larger areas, reducing the requirement for regular emptying. Consider designs with easy-to-empty dustbins for included benefit.

Smart Features and App Control: Modern robot vacuums frequently come loaded with smart functions. App control is highly preferable, enabling you to schedule cleanings, screen progress, develop virtual walls and no-go zones, start spot cleaning, and even manage the robot from another location. Voice control integration adds another layer of convenience.

Mop Functionality (2-in-1 Models): Some robot vacuums offer a 2-in-1 vacuuming and mopping functionality. These designs normally have a water tank and a mopping pad that damp-mops hard floorings after vacuuming. While convenient, 2-in-1 designs often stand out more at vacuuming than deep mopping. Consider your primary cleaning requirements-- if mopping is a concern, a devoted robot mop might be a better alternative.

Pet Hair Handling Capabilities: For pet owners, robust pet hair dealing with features are critical. Look for designs with:
Strong Suction: To efficiently raise pet hair from carpets and upholstery.Tangle-Free Brushes: Designed to withstand hair wrapping and maintain cleaning performance.Larger Dustbins: To accommodate the increased volume of pet hair.HEPA Filters: To capture pet dander and allergens.
Sound Level: Robot vacuums do produce sound throughout operation. Consider the noise level, specifically if you plan to run the robot throughout times when you are home or conscious sound. Some models are designed to operate more silently than others.

Obstacle Avoidance and Object Recognition: Advanced models boast obstacle avoidance and object recognition abilities. This enables them to browse around furniture legs, shoes, and even pet waste, preventing getting stuck or spreading messes.

Rate Range: Robot vacuums range in cost from affordable alternatives to high-end, feature-rich models. Determine your spending plan and prioritize the features that are essential to you within that rate range.

Tips for Optimal Automatic Hoover Performance

To ensure your automatic hoover runs effectively and offers long-lasting service, follow these basic ideas:
Prepare the Space: Before each cleaning session, declutter floorings by eliminating cable televisions, small toys, and loose items that could block the robot's course or get tangled in the brushes.Regularly Empty the Dustbin: Empty the dustbin often, ideally after each cleaning cycle, to maintain optimal suction power and avoid overflow.Tidy Brushes and Filters: Regularly clean the brushes and filters according to the producer's directions. This makes sure effective cleaning and prolongs the lifespan of these components.Keep Charging Dock Area: Keep the charging dock area clear and available for the robot to easily return for recharging.Think About Virtual Walls or No-Go Zones: Utilize virtual walls or no-go zones (if your model supports them) to restrict the robot from going into areas you do not desire cleaned, such as fragile rugs or pet feeding areas.Software application Updates: If your robot vacuum has app connection, guarantee you keep the software updated to take advantage of efficiency enhancements and new features.Periodic Deep Cleaning: While robot vacuums preserve day-to-day cleanliness, occasional deep cleaning with a conventional vacuum is still recommended for areas the robot may miss out on or for more intensive cleaning needs.
